Comprehending Pediatric Dental Care
Child dentistry is a specialized branch of dentistry that focuses on the oral health of children from birth through their teenage years. This field is dedicated to addressing the specific dental needs of children, as well as their emotional and emotional factors. Youth dentists are equipped to manage a wide range of dental issues that emerge during childhood, using techniques that are appropriate and secure for kids.
One of the key goals of child dentistry is to foster a constructive dental experience for children, which is crucial for developing lifelong good oral health habits. Youth dentists not only provide routine dental care, but they also inform both kids and their parents about correct dental hygiene practices. By teaching kids how to care for their teeth and why it's crucial, pediatric dentists help them foster a sense of accountability toward their dental health.
Moreover, pediatric dentist s are skilled to manage common dental issues often seen in children, such as dental caries, irregular teeth, and issues related to teething and thumb sucking. They use kid-friendly communication and techniques to manage anxiety, ensuring that their child patients feel comfortable and content during visits. This tailored approach helps to create positive associations with dental care, prompting kids to keep regular dental visits throughout their lives.
Selecting the Right Pediatric Dentist
Finding a suitable pediatric dentist to treat your child is important in order to establishing a favorable dental experience from an early age. Commence by requesting recommendations within family, friends, or your child's pediatrician. Online reviews and testimonials can also provide valuable insights into the dentist's knowledge and approach. Seek out a pediatric dentist who specializes in treating children and holds the necessary credentials and experience.
Once you have a selection, consider visiting the dental offices to assess the environment. A child-friendly atmosphere is key in making your child feel comfortable and safe. Pay attention to staff interaction with kids and how the office is designed to cater to young patients. A welcoming space can make dental visits much less intimidating for your child.
Lastly, schedule an preliminary consultation to discuss your child's particular needs and any concerns you might be facing. This visit allows you to evaluate the dentist's communication style and readiness to engage with both you and your child. Trust your instincts; selecting a dentist that resonates with you and your child will ultimately contribute to a beneficial dental experience and promote a lifelong commitment to oral health.
Preventative Healthcare and Typical Treatments
Preventive care is at the core of pediatric dentistry, ensuring that children develop healthy oral habits from an early age. Pediatric dentists focus on education, instructing both children and parents the significance of regular brushing and flossing, a balanced diet, and regular dental check-ups. They stress the role of fluoride treatments, which help strengthen tooth enamel and protect against cavities, making it an crucial part of preventive care for young patients.
